Product Description

Add delicate elegance and cottage garden charm with Pink Petticoat Columbine Flower Seeds, a graceful variety known for its soft pink, frilly blossoms that resemble layers of a ballerina’s skirt. These premium-quality seeds offer high germination rates and are well-suited for garden beds, borders, woodland edges, or containers. Whether you’re a first-time gardener or an experienced grower, this Columbine is easy to plant, thrives in partial shade, and brings a whimsical touch to any garden.

Perfect for pollinator-friendly spaces, these dainty blooms attract bees, butterflies, and hummingbirds while blooming through late spring and early summer. Growing your own flowers from seed offers the joy of watching beauty unfold day by day, and with Pink Petticoat Columbine, your garden will be dressed to impress in layers of soft pastel petals. Pink Petticoat Columbine is a charming cottage garden flower known for its delicate, frilly pink blossoms and fern-like foliage. A favorite among pollinators, it adds soft color and elegance to shaded garden beds and woodland borders.
